About 13 Abbots Close
13 Abbots Close is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Hassocks (BN6 8PH). It has a recorded floor area of 77 m² (around 829 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(March 2019)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in October 2008 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and window efficiency went from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 80).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
Across 2009–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£492,000 is 18.6%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£501/sq ft) was about 32.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old July 2019 for £415,000.
